In the absence of any FAU zeolite Y, hydrogen fluoride (HF) is not used, and a method of producing an AEI zeolite by hydrothermal synthesis is provided. When this method is used, the resulting gel composition comprises at least one source of silica, at least one source of alumina, at least one organic structure directing agent (OSDA), a source of alkali metal ions, and water. This gel composition has a molar ratio, that is, SiO 2 /Al 2 O 3 16:1 to 100:1; M 2 O/SiO 2 0.15:1 to 0.30:1; ROH/SiO 2 0.05:1 to 0.20:1; And H 2 O/SiO 2 5:1 to 20:1 [wherein M is an alkali metal ion and R is an organic group derived from OSDA]. This gel composition is a crystalline AEI zeolite showing a ratio of silica to alumina greater than 8:1 (SiO 2 :Al 2 O 3 ) after reacting for 15 to 168 hours at a temperature between 135°C and about 180°C.
